- David LopezApr 17, 2023 · 3 years agoThe ex-dividend date is an important event for investors in traditional stocks, but its impact on the price of cryptocurrencies is not as significant. Cryptocurrencies are not typically associated with dividends like stocks, so the ex-dividend date does not have a direct impact on their price. The price of cryptocurrencies is primarily driven by factors such as supply and demand, market sentiment, and overall market conditions. Therefore, while the ex-dividend date may have some indirect effects on the price of cryptocurrencies, its impact is generally minimal compared to other factors.
